Randle vs Randy

American parents have registered 334,472 Randys since 1880, against 2,936 Randles. Randy is still ahead, with 198 babies in 2025.

Which name is older

Half of the Randys alive today are over 61; half the Randles are over 59. That is 2 years between them: two names in use at the same time, worn by two different generations.
